  • A geoarchaeological case study in the chora of Pergamon, western Turkey, to reconstruct the late Holocene landscape development and Settlement History
    Quaternary International, 2015
    Co-Authors: Steffen Schneider, Albrecht Matthaei, Marlen Schlöffel, Cornelius Meyer, Mario Kronwald, Anna Pint, Brigitta Schütt
    Abstract:

    Abstract This paper investigates the late Holocene landscape development and Settlement History of the central Bakircay valley (the ancient Kaikos valley) in western Turkey, which exemplifies a buried archaeological site approximately 12 km SW of Pergamon. A minimally intrusive geoarchaeological approach was applied by coupling an archaeological survey, geophysical exploration, geomorphological mapping and sedimentological analysis of drilling cores and pre-existing outcrops. The geomorphological and lithostratigraphical results imply that in the early and middle Holocene the site was situated on a depositional piedmont plain that was protected from the annual Bakircay floods. Over the past two millennia, the Bakircay flood plain was gradually aggraded and the site became prone to flooding. Despite the limitations of non-intrusive archaeological investigations, three scenarios were developed on the function and age of the buried site. Hence, the site was either a sanctuary from the 2nd century AD, a luxurious estate from the 4th–8th century AD, or a lime kiln from late Antique/Byzantine times.

  • late holocene human environmental interactions in the eastern mediterranean Settlement History and paleogeography of an ancient aegean hill top Settlement
    Quaternary International, 2014
    Co-Authors: Steffen Schneider, Albrecht Matthaei, Wiebke Bebermeier, Brigitta Schütt
    Abstract:

    Abstract Interactions between Settlement History and landscape evolution of a hill-top Settlement on the West Anatolian Coast near ancient Pergamon (modern Bergama) were studied by a combination of archaeological and geographical investigations. Ceramics, ancient literary and epigraphic texts, numismatics and architectural remains show that the hill-top had been populated since late Bronze Age times. From the sixth century BC until the change of the eras, the hill was occupied by a Greek polis – Atarneus – and was abandoned afterwards. It was newly populated in the second half of the twelfth and the first half of the thirteenth century AD. The lithostratigraphy of nine drilling cores, arranged in three transects and dated by AMS radiocarbon dating, shows that during the past 4000 years the sedimentary plains surrounding the Settlement hill were aggraded by braided and meandering rivers, while colluviation and alluvial fan deposition occurred at the foot-slopes. Sedimentation totaled about 5–7 m in the past 4000 years, evidencing a “drowning” of the landscape in terrestrial sediments. Although channels shifted repeatedly and alluvial fan deposition fluctuated, the depositional system did not change in general during the past 4000 years. This striking resistance to the changing Settlement and land use intensity is an effect of the distinct modification of the slopes through terracing that countervailed erosion and likewise increased the buffering capacity of the sediment storages on the slopes. There is no evidence that landscape deterioration contributed to the abandonment of the Settlement hill. Rather, socio-economic factors were crucial for the rise and fall of the Settlements occupying the hill.

  • Settlement History and Urban Planning at Zincirli Höyük, Southern Turkey
    Journal of Mediterranean Archaeology, 2010
    Co-Authors: Jesse Casana, Jason T. Hermann
    Abstract:

    This paper presents results of geophysical survey at Zincirli Hoyuk, a 40-hectare site in southern Turkey dating to the early first millennium bc. The site’s lower town offers ideal circumstances for magnetic gradiometry, and survey results from this area, combined with the results of excavations from the 1890s on the central high citadel, now reveal a nearly complete plan of the ancient city. The results therefore present a unique opportunity to explore the relationship between the production of urban space and the social and historical forces that drove it. Our evidence from Zincirli strongly suggests a pattern of distributed authority in creating the built environment of the city, whereby the king and his administrators planned and constructed the circular walls, streets, and citadel, but according to which individual elite households were probably left to plan and build their own residential compounds. The spatial relationships of these features raise important questions regarding social organization at Iron Age Zincirli. The results also offer a model for understanding the unique spatiality of new cities that were founded throughout Syria and Anatolia during the early first millennium and highlight the relationship of Zincirli to these and other planned cities of the ancient Near East.

  • Settlement History and Material Culture in Southwest Turkey: Report on the 2008-2010 Survey at Çaltılar Höyük (northern Lycia)
    Anatolian Studies, 2011
    Co-Authors: Nicoletta Momigliano, T Greaves, Tamar Hodos, B. Aksoy, M Brown, Mustafa Kibaroğlu
    Abstract:

    This report presents the main results of research activities carried out at Caltilar Hoyuk, northern Lycia, southwest Turkey, between 2008 and 2010. During this period, an international team undertook topographic, archaeological and geophysical surveys, together with artefact studies and analyses, aimed at determining the nature and extent of occupation at the site, and offering new data about the Settlement History and material culture of this region in pre-Classical times. The results of this work suggest that the site was occupied from at least the fourth millennium (Late Chalcolithic) to the middle of the sixth century BC, a date that coincides with the Persian conquest of Lycia, with only scant evidence of use/occupation after this phase. In addition, the nature of our finds suggests that the site, despite its location in the summer pastures ( yayla ) and at a considerable altitude (1,250m), was well-connected to other Anatolian and Aegean regions, and probably served as more than just a minor seasonal agro-pastoral Settlement, particularly during its Early Bronze Age and Late Iron Age periods of occupation. The evidence relevant to the second millennium BC is too limited at present to allow further interpretation about the nature of occupation at the site, but is significant per se, especially in view of the scanty archaeological remains of this period in the region, and despite the numerous references to the Lukka people and Settlements available in documentary sources.
